Infortar acquired its own shares on the Nasdaq Tallinn Stock Exchange from 2-6 March 2026, with a total of 326,946 shares bought back at an average price of approximately €46,500 per day. This move is part of a share buyback programme initiated on 20 October 2025. The programme is managed by SEB Pank AS.
